知识屋:更实用的电脑技术知识网站
所在位置:首页 > 操作系统 > linux

linux中,用户登录时发现无法找到家目录

发布时间:2014-09-05 13:42:39作者:知识屋

linux中,用户登录时发现无法找到家目录
 
环境:windows 7 + virtualbox + fedora 15 kde
 
前段时间,在学习linux用户管理时,操作了修改用户操作,发现被修改的用户admin在登录时显示无法找到家目录,紧接着就退出回到登录界面。
 
以root用户登录后,打开查看lyc用户相关的几个文件/etc/passwd /etc/shadow /etc/group /etc/gshadow文件,发现了问题
 
命令:# grep /etc/passwd /etc/shadow /etc/group /etc/gshadow
 

 
 
在/etc/passwd文件中,家目录部分出现了问题
 
于是将
 
修改成
 
admin:x:500:502::/home/admin:/bin/bash  
 
(多加一个冒号:,/home/admin前面的两个冒号之间是描述部分,可有可无)
 
 
再次以admin登录,成功!
(免责声明:文章内容如涉及作品内容、版权和其它问题,请及时与我们联系,我们将在第一时间删除内容,文章内容仅供参考)
收藏
  • 人气文章
  • 最新文章
  • 下载排行榜
  • 热门排行榜